Sketchware-Pro / Sketchware-Pro

Sketchware Pro's sources in Java. Now anyone can contribute to Sketchware Pro.
https://sketchware.pro
Other
863 stars 254 forks source link

Rewrite entire app in Kotlin #144

Closed y9san9 closed 2 years ago

JavkhlanK commented 2 years ago

why though, the app works fine lol

y9san9 commented 2 years ago

Everybody knows Kotlin is the best language, so just wonder Sketchware Pro in Kotlin

y9san9 commented 2 years ago

You can only have monoids in category of endofunctors in Kotlin, not Java

JavkhlanK commented 2 years ago

alright sounds cool, but does Sketchware Pro need it? I don't think so.

dmitrijkotov634 commented 2 years ago

i want to see the source code of Sketchware Pro on kotlin. Kotlin is the best programming language.

y9vad9 commented 2 years ago

Totally agree with @dmitrijkotov634 and @y9san9

y9slavabogu commented 2 years ago

Yes, you have to do it. 100%

TheGamer1294 commented 2 years ago

imagine teamwork with 7 people just for a dumb idea

JavkhlanK commented 2 years ago

rewrite for what tho? there aren't any benefits of it right now, and we can't re-architecture the whole app

iyxan23 commented 2 years ago

I'd say it's an interesting idea, kotlin is great for writing less codes and good for focusing on what you want to do, It can make the source code more organized and readable. Although, It would be a very big consideration as kotlin does has it's ups and downs impact to this project.

And as JavkhlanK said, "we can't re-architecture the whole app", It would be better for you guys to create a new sketchware from scratch in kotlin rather than asking a very big long-existed java-dependant project to convert it's entire source to kotlin.

In short: we're not ready yet.

Mochiziku commented 2 years ago

🙏

littlecat-dev commented 2 years ago

I love kotlin!!!

khaled-0 commented 2 years ago

no, java is love

yallxe commented 2 years ago

Totally agree.